Ordinals
beta
Address bc1qrs8fj4ft9vskjz6csqjwxdavlztafrfyn9j7ek
sat balance
11904
outputs
f18f4fd9c4668843092ce479787ee88fee573a95845261d2a1be2b6fb3d762f9:0